When integrating the KIA6213-S Audio Power Amplifier IC into your circuit design, understanding its voltage constraints is vital for both performance and longevity. Typically, the KIA6213-S Audio Power Amplifier IC is designed to operate within a flexible supply voltage range, often spanning from 4V to 12V, making it ideal for battery-operated devices and standard 9V or 12V DC systems. However, engineers must be cautious not to exceed the absolute maximum supply voltage, which is generally around 15V. Operating the KIA6213-S Audio Power Amplifier IC near its upper limit requires excellent power supply regulation to prevent transient spikes from triggering the internal overvoltage protection or causing permanent silicon damage. For optimal audio fidelity and thermal stability, a stable 9V rail is frequently recommended. Exceeding these parameters can lead to increased Total Harmonic Distortion (THD) or immediate device failure. Always ensure that decoupling capacitors are placed as close as possible to the Vcc pin of the KIA6213-S Audio Power Amplifier IC to maintain a clean voltage supply and suppress high-frequency noise.
Effective thermal management is critical when deploying the KIA6213-S Audio Power Amplifier IC in high-duty-cycle applications. Although the KIA6213-S Audio Power Amplifier IC features an integrated thermal shutdown circuit, relying on this safety mechanism for regular operation is not recommended. The Single In-line Package (SIP) is designed for efficient heat transfer, but in applications where the IC is driving low-impedance loads at high volumes, an external heatsink may be necessary. When mounting the KIA6213-S Audio Power Amplifier IC, ensure there is adequate airflow around the package. If the design allows, use a thermal interface material (TIM) between the IC body and a metal chassis or dedicated fins to lower the junction-to-ambient thermal resistance. Proper PCB copper pouring around the ground pins can also act as a heat spreader. Monitoring the case temperature of the KIA6213-S Audio Power Amplifier IC during the prototyping phase will help you determine if the thermal dissipation is sufficient to keep the internal temperature well below the shutdown threshold, ensuring uninterrupted audio performance.
The KIA6213-S Audio Power Amplifier IC is highly versatile regarding load matching, but it is typically optimized for 4-ohm to 8-ohm speaker impedances. When driving an 8-ohm load, the KIA6213-S Audio Power Amplifier IC operates with higher efficiency and lower heat generation, which is preferable for high-fidelity consumer electronics where sound clarity is paramount. Conversely, using a 4-ohm load will allow the KIA6213-S Audio Power Amplifier IC to deliver higher output power, which is beneficial for applications requiring more volume, such as portable intercoms or automotive alerts. However, users should be aware that a 4-ohm load increases the current draw and thermal output of the KIA6213-S Audio Power Amplifier IC, which may slightly increase the THD at peak volumes. It is essential to match the output coupling capacitor value to the load impedance to ensure a flat frequency response; for example, a larger capacitor is generally required for 4-ohm loads to maintain low-frequency performance. Always verify that the peak current does not exceed the rated limits of the KIA6213-S Audio Power Amplifier IC.
The KIA6213-S Audio Power Amplifier IC is primarily designed as a single-ended audio power stage, making it straightforward to implement in mono or multi-channel systems. While some amplifiers are specifically built for Bridge-Tied Load (BTL) operation, using the KIA6213-S Audio Power Amplifier IC in a BTL configuration requires two separate ICs and an inverted input signal for one of them. By bridging two KIA6213-S Audio Power Amplifier IC units, you can theoretically quadruple the power output into the same load, provided the power supply can handle the increased current. However, this setup doubles the heat dissipation requirements and complicates the PCB layout. For most standard applications, the single-ended output of the KIA6213-S Audio Power Amplifier IC provides sufficient gain and clarity. If you do attempt a BTL configuration with the KIA6213-S Audio Power Amplifier IC, pay close attention to ground loops and phase alignment to avoid cancellation effects or instability that could damage the speakers or the ICs themselves.

To extract the highest audio quality from the KIA6213-S Audio Power Amplifier IC, a disciplined PCB layout is essential. The KIA6213-S Audio Power Amplifier IC is sensitive to ground loops and electromagnetic interference (EMI). You should implement a star-grounding technique, ensuring that the signal ground and power ground meet at a single point to prevent noise injection into the input stage. Keep the input traces to the KIA6213-S Audio Power Amplifier IC as short as possible and away from high-current output traces or switching power supply components. Placing the input coupling capacitor close to the input pin of the KIA6213-S Audio Power Amplifier IC helps block DC offsets effectively. Furthermore, the power supply bypass capacitor must be situated immediately adjacent to the Vcc and GND pins of the KIA6213-S Audio Power Amplifier IC to provide a low-impedance path for high-frequency currents. If your design uses a double-sided PCB, utilizing a ground plane can significantly improve the Signal-to-Noise Ratio (SNR) and overall stability of the KIA6213-S Audio Power Amplifier IC.
